A leading Malaysian property developer is seeking a Personal Secretary to support the CEO by managing schedules, correspondence, and communication with stakeholders. The ideal candidate will possess at least a Diploma and have 3-5 years of relevant experience. Strong organizational skills and proficiency in multiple languages, including English and Mandarin, are essential for this role. The position offers various perks including medical and wellness programs.

Provide a full range of confidential secretarial duties and overall administration support to the Chief Executive Officer (CEO).
Plan, maintain, and coordinate the CEO's scheduling management, travel and accommodation arrangements, arrange lunch/dinner venue reservations, and plan annual leaves.
Effectively support the CEO by compiling, proofreading, and reviewing all incoming calls, emails, documents, and ensuring timely correspondence and approvals.
Organize meetings and follow up on actions post-meetings. Take meeting minutes or provide general assistance during presentations if required.
Respond to Board members and other stakeholders' queries in a timely and professional manner, both orally and in writing.
Liaise and coordinate with HODs, internal staff, Board members, and Business Associates.
Plan, organize, manage, and coordinate the Driver’s schedule.
Job Requirements:
Candidate must possess at least a Diploma, Advanced/Higher/Graduate Diploma, Bachelor's Degree, Post Graduate Diploma, Professional Degree, Master's Degree, in any field.
At least 3-5 years of working experience in a related field is required.
Self-motivated, result-oriented, problem-solving skills, confident, positive personality, and good business acumen.
High accuracy, resourcefulness, attention to detail, and strong work ethics.
Effective communication in English, Mandarin, and Bahasa Malaysia (spoken and written). Proficiency in Mandarin is preferred for communication with Mandarin-speaking clients.
Able to work independently and interact professionally across departments.

Hua Yang Berhad, established in 1978, is a prominent Malaysian property developer specializing in affordable housing. Listed on Bursa Malaysia since 2002, it has a strong track record of delivering quality residential and commercial projects across Malaysia.
Perks and benefits include medical outpatient care, wellness programs, group insurance, allowances, employee welfare programs, parking, personal development, and family care benefits.
